We are seeking a motivated and ambitious Senior Engineering Manager to lead the development of a new station project as a Contractors Engineering Manager (CEM), progressing from outline design through to commissioning and handover. This flagship Network Rail scheme spans an estimated 3–4 years and offers an excellent opportunity for an individual looking to further develop their expertise while taking on increasing levels of responsibility.
RoleResponsibilities
- Responsible and accountable for delivering Engineering Assurance across all stages of the project lifecycle.
- Function as the Project Engineering Manager, working with the project team to develop solutions that are safe by design, constructable, and maintainable.
- Maintain overall accountability for quality management, design management, and information management throughout the project.
- Collaborate closely with Heads of Discipline and the Project Manager to ensure technical governance, alignment, and compliance.
- Lead and manage engineering resources to meet project requirements and performance expectations.
- Contribute to all engineering activities at both pre‑contract and delivery stages.
- Serve as the primary point of contact for customers and liaise on engineering matters.
- Ensure staff training, competency records, and compliance documentation are up to date and maintained.
- Support the mobilisation of new contracts and contribute to health, safety, quality, and environmental planning.
- Manage relationships with consulting engineers and internal teams to ensure coordinated delivery.
- Oversee design management activities and implement agreed design governance processes.
- Promote innovation, knowledge sharing, and continuous improvement across the business unit.
- Ensure adherence to regulations and support associated audits and reporting activities.
